How Hair Transplant San Diego Actually Works

A hair transplant is a surgical procedure designed to restore hair in areas affected by thinning or balding. Using follicular unit extraction (FUE) or follicular unit transplantation (FUT), experienced clinics carefully relocate healthy follicles from donor regions—often the back and sides of the scalp—to thinning or bare zones. The process is minimally invasive, typically performed on an outpatient basis with precise precision, ensuring natural density and cohesion.
